Electrical Products is a business unit of Siemens Smart infrastructure. Siemens Smart Infrastructure (SI) is shaping the market for intelligent, adaptive infrastructure for today and the future. It addresses the pressing challenges of urbanization and climate change by connecting energy systems, buildings and industries. SI provides customers with a comprehensive end-to-end portfolio from a single source – with products, systems, solutions, and services from the point of power generation all the way to consumption. With an increasingly digitalized ecosystem, it helps customers thrive and communities progress while contributing toward protecting the planet. SI creates environments that care. Electrical Products provides the low voltage distribution and control systems and components that support SI solutions. The Project Manager for Wiring Standards and Productivity will lead multidisciplinary teams that will revolutionize wiring methods from customer configuration through delivery of products. Success will be measured as the adoption rate and sustainable use of wiring standards in complex electrical products and related manufacturing environment.

The goals of this project are:
• To create configurations for 80% of electric content
• Integrate Electrical designs in 3D E-CAD with M-CAD and other business systems
• Driving productivity through Manufacturing via adoption and use of digital methods
• Realization of above vision for Systems products produced in the Grand Prairie, TX facility.
